We provide free and confidential short-term counseling to you and your household members. We provide group debriefings with trained peers following critical incidents.

 

All of our counselors share a passion for supporting first responders and all are experienced helping people resolve exposure to trauma.

critical incident debriefings and group support

EAPFirst provides clinical services and critical incident stress debriefings to your department following a tragic incident. During this pandemic, all of our services are conducted via HIPAA-compliant telecounseling.
